The Budgetary Treatment of Proposals to Change the Nation's Health Insurance System
U.S. Congressional Budget Office [CBO] May 28, 2009 Excerpt: The Congress is currently considering various approaches for instituting major changes in the nation's system of health insurance. Some of those proposals would significantly expand the federal government's role in that system, thus raising the question of how such changes might be reflected in the federal budget. This brief describes the approach that the Congressional Budget Office (CBO) will take in judging the appropriate budgetary treatment. [Target page links to the 7-page PDF and to the Blog posting.] |
